Technical Questions

Technical questions about AI focus on its architecture, algorithms, and machine learning processes. Inquiries often revolve around the types of neural networks used, such as convolutional and recurrent networks. Understanding the programming languages facilitates AI’s development, with Python being a common choice. Questions may also examine data requirements necessary for training models effectively. Developers frequently ask about optimization techniques, such as reinforcement learning and transfer learning, to improve AI performance. These technical aspects shape the foundation for AI deployment in various applications.

Ethical Questions

Ethical questions about AI highlight its societal implications and moral responsibilities. Queries regarding privacy, data protection, and bias in algorithms raise significant concerns. Many individuals consider how AI impacts decision-making processes, especially in sensitive areas like criminal justice and healthcare. Discussions about accountability in AI systems play a crucial role in ethical considerations. Furthermore, people often question the potential for AI to perpetuate inequality or reinforce existing societal biases. These inquiries emphasize the importance of ethical frameworks in guiding AI development.
